**Note about Pesticide Applications:

The Federal Insecticide, Fungicide and Rodenticide Act (FIFRA) is the U.S. law regulating pesticides. The United States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) is responsible for registering or licensing pesticide products for use in the United States. Every registered product has a label that is approved and required by the EPA. These labels are the law when it comes to pesticide application. Any application of a pesticide product that is not in compliance with the labeled directions and precautions may be subject to civil or criminal penalties. These labels are put into place to help protect people and our environment. Whether products are purchased over the counter or being applied by a pest professional, the label must be followed.
